What is ICD-10 code D17?
D17 is an 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for Benign lipomatous neoplasm.
Is D17 a billable code?
No. D17 is a category/header code, not billable on its own — use one of its more specific child codes instead.
What ICD-10-CM chapter is D17 in?
D17 falls under Chapter 2: Neoplasms.
